    Originally posted by Scipio2009
    My guess is likely a situation not all that different from what Chris Algieri was being faced with a short while ago; Javier Bustillo (the smallest name in the picture to me) had the original contract with Pedraza, Gary Shaw got involved along the way, with Lou DiBella joining on to finally get Pedraza over the finish and into stardom [Algieri is signed with Star Boxing, who had to give up a few options to Banner Promotions to get the Provodnikov fight, who then subsequently had to give an option to Top Rank for the Pacquiao fight].

    Pedraza's father is trainer/manager (and I doubt that he's gouging his son for two checks), so the circle is basically Pedraza'a father leading things for him, DiBella/Shaw looking to negotiate the fights, and Haymon being around to get Pedraza/Pedraza to hopefully follow the most sensible path but leaving them with the final decision.
